Match the flexibility-related term with the correct description.
A. ligaments
B. ballistic stretching
C. hypermobility
D. passive stretching
E. static stretching
A. fibrous tissue that connects bone to bone
B. technique involving quick, jerky or bouncing movements in which force is provided by momentum
C. excessive range of motion
D. allowing an outside force to assist in the stretching rather than using the contraction of a muscle group
E. technique involving a slow, steady stretch with a hold at the end of the range of motion
